About this property

ASSISI FAMILY HOME, the old town center with or without car

In a strategic position, reachable with the urban bus, between the church of Saint Claire and the monastery of Saint Damian. We have all the advantages of living in the center, but no problems: no difficulty of access or parking! 2000 square meters of private olive grove touching the historic city walls (we will taste our organic olive oil). This was not a vacation home: the two apartments on the lower level are very equipped, furnished with family furniture. We live on the top floor.

Why they chose this property

Assisi is worth the trip: a town of history, faith, art, a symbol of peace for the still living presence of St. Francis, it's in the very center of Umbria, the green heart of Italy. From here you can reach other jewels of the region such as Spoleto, Spello, Perugia, Todi, Gubbio, Bevagna, Orvieto, Montefalco, Norcia, the Trasimeno lake and many more, as well as Firenze, Roma, Arezzo, Urbino, the Frasassi caves and many more.
Ancestors built our home on an olive grove in 1925. They designed a villa in brick and stone having loggias, terraces and arch windows looking at the town and at the surrounding garden. From 2004 we inherited the property and have moved here.

What makes this property unique

After various events, we have made a careful restoration, respecting the charm of the old house. The location allows you to appreciate both the beauty of the monuments both the landscape, between city and countryside. In our olive grove, sunny and sheltered, you can hear the tolling of the bells of the monastery of Santa Chiara but also maybe find pheasants, squirrels, hedgehogs or fireflies!
